#210e58 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#210e58 is composed of 12.9% red, 5.5%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62.5% cyan, 84.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.5% black. It has a hue angle of 255.4 degrees, a saturation of 72.5% and a lightness of 20%. #210e58 color hex could be obtained by blending #421cb0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

#210e58 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#210e58 has RGB values of R:33, G:14,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0.63, M:0.84, Y:0, K:0.65. Its decimal value is 2166360.
